Portugal’s Living Program: A Comprehensive Overview

Portugal's Golden Visa Scheme, officially known as the "Autorização de Residência para Atividade de Investimento" (ARI), grants a pathway to gain long-term residence in Portugal for investors who make a considerable financial commitment to the country. This highly-regarded option may been modified throughout the years, with current regulations focusing on targeted investment areas to promote regional development and resolve concerns regarding housing affordability. Potential applicants should carefully consider the requirement criteria, which encompass investments in areas such as property, scientific research, capital capital, businesses creating employment, and artistic ventures. Portugal's Gold Visa Investment: Opportunities & Pathway

Portugal’s Golden Visa program continues to attract applicants worldwide, offering a path to residency and, ultimately, citizenship. This program provides a unique opportunity to contribute to the Portugal's get more info economy while securing a foothold in the European Union. Several funding options exist, including property acquisition, money transfers, job creation, scientific research, and artistic/cultural impact. The procedure generally involves demonstrating a substantial funding – the minimum threshold varies depending on the chosen method – submitting a comprehensive application, undergoing due diligence, and obtaining approval from the Portuguese Immigration and Borders Service (SEF, now AIMA).
